Mother India International Residential Public School Society Keezhattingal

High Court Of Kerala|21 May, 2014
|

JUDGMENT / ORDER

Without going into the merits of the matter, the petitioner seeks only consideration of the stay application filed before the Commissioner of Income Tax (Appeals) III, Cochin produced herein as Exts. P3 and P3(a) to P3(f) for various assessment years. The demands arise from assessment completed after seizure effected under Section 132 of the Income Tax Act, 1961. Admittedly, the petitioner has filed the appeal within time and has also moved the stay applications, which are pending before the first appellate authority, the 2nd respondent herein. 2. In view of the limited prayers made, this Court deems it fit that, the 2nd respondent be directed to consider the stay applications produced herein as Exts.P3 and P3(a) to P3(f) within a period of one month from the date of receipt of a certified copy of this judgment.
W.P.(C) No. 12787 of 2014 2
3. Needless to say the recovery proceedings shall be kept in abeyance for a period of six weeks from today, subject however to orders passed in Exts.P3 and P3(a) to P3(f) stay petitions. In the circumstances, of the directions above, the 4th respondent Bank shall not give effect to Ext.P5.
With the above directions and observations, the Writ Petition stands disposed of.
